Transaction d11eae41a4304fa55077f45a3e280d5bb702038eda40fa46e931bbdf28df2b6d
2 Input
1 Outputs
- d11eae41a4304fa55077f45a3e280d5bb702038eda40fa46e931bbdf28df2b6d:0
value 7557628
address 3DctErhfVJWKXhiQ6Cs2CV1tB3wnNBXdPV